  • Posted by farmerdill (Augusta Georgia - Zone 8a) on May 21, 2019 8:16 AM concerning plant:
    Gallican is a second early variety. Very hard heads uniform in time and size. Advertised at 3-5 lbs, mine are running around 4 lbs consistently. Plants are vigorous.
